Clermont County approves annexation to Batavia over airport safety objections
Summary
The Clermont County Board of Commissioners granted Resolution 183.25 to annex territory to the village of Batavia despite public comments and commissioners’ concerns about runway protection zone safety at the Clermont County Airport. The vote was 2–1 following legal staff confirmation that statutory criteria were met.
The Clermont County Board of Commissioners voted Dec. 10 to grant a petition to annex a parcel of land to the village of Batavia, approving Resolution 183.25 after legal counsel confirmed the petition met the statutory criteria under Ohio law.
During public participation, Chuck Gallagher, manager of the Clermont County Airport, urged the board to delay action or attach a condition that no construction occur until the airport’s master plan is complete, describing potential hazard scenarios inside the runway protection zone (RPZ) off Runway 22. "If this goes to a different jurisdiction...we may lose that zoning authority," Gallagher said, urging the board to preserve the "straight-ahead option" for aircraft…
